                              • Originally posted by e4dragongunner View Post
                                I just realized....no one is going to buy all the other corsairs out there any more ...Cept maybe the Elite.....
                                In all seriousness, the others are a different size, different price point, so I'm sure they won't go extinct just yet. The Eflite one, to me, is one of the least desirable since it's quite small (1.2m) and loaded with AS3X, which not everyone wants or needs. The FMS 1400mm series is still a nice size for many people. There may even be a market for the cheapy HobbyKing version as not all who purchase will realize you get what you pay for. The other "off brands" have never sold well anyway.
